首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法获取Snowflake目标表的dbname、rolename、userid、上次访问日期、读/写访问权限

Snowflake是一种云原生的数据仓库解决方案,它提供了强大的数据存储和分析能力。在Snowflake中,dbname代表数据库名称,rolename代表角色名称,userid代表用户ID,上次访问日期表示用户最近一次访问的日期,读/写访问权限表示用户对目标表的读写权限。

由于无法获取Snowflake目标表的dbname、rolename、userid、上次访问日期、读/写访问权限,可能是由于以下原因:

  1. 访问权限不足:当前用户没有足够的权限来获取这些信息。在Snowflake中,访问权限是通过角色(role)来管理的,如果用户所属的角色没有相应的权限,则无法获取这些信息。
  2. 数据库配置限制:Snowflake的管理员可能对数据库配置进行了限制,禁止了获取这些信息的操作。这可能是出于安全考虑或者其他管理策略。

针对这个问题,可以采取以下解决方案:

  1. 确认权限:首先,确保当前用户所属的角色具有获取这些信息的权限。可以联系Snowflake管理员或者具有相应权限的用户来确认。
  2. 查询系统表:Snowflake提供了一些系统表,可以查询其中的元数据信息来获取目标表的相关信息。例如,可以查询INFORMATION_SCHEMA.TABLES系统表来获取目标表的数据库名称、表名称等信息。
  3. 联系支持:如果以上方法无法解决问题,可以联系Snowflake的技术支持团队,向他们提供详细的情况描述,并寻求他们的帮助和指导。

腾讯云的相关产品推荐:

腾讯云提供了一系列与云计算相关的产品,以下是一些推荐的产品和对应的介绍链接:

  1. 云数据库 TencentDB:腾讯云的云数据库服务,提供了多种数据库引擎和存储类型,适用于不同的业务场景。链接:https://cloud.tencent.com/product/tencentdb
  2. 云服务器 CVM:腾讯云的云服务器产品,提供了弹性的计算资源,可用于部署应用程序和承载服务。链接:https://cloud.tencent.com/product/cvm
  3. 云存储 COS:腾讯云的对象存储服务,提供了安全可靠的数据存储和访问能力,适用于各种数据类型和规模。链接:https://cloud.tencent.com/product/cos
  4. 人工智能平台 AI Lab:腾讯云的人工智能平台,提供了丰富的人工智能工具和服务,支持开发和部署各种智能应用。链接:https://cloud.tencent.com/product/ai

请注意,以上推荐的产品仅作为参考,具体选择应根据实际需求和情况进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MongoDB用户和角色解释系列(上)

对视图授予权限与授予底层集合权限是分开指定。每个角色只应该为该角色授予必要权限,并且只应该为用户分配适合其需求角色。...如果你不创建此管理用户,则在启用访问控制时将无法登录或创建新用户和角色。 2.1 本地主机异常 如果在没有创建至少一个管理用户情况下启用访问控制,则无法登录。...通过只更改一个角色,您将更新所有使用它用户权限。否则,需要为每个用户对一组或一类用户访问需求进行更改。...因此,如果你想检查它们,你必须在定义它们数据库中进行: > use '' 要获取数据库所有角色,请使用 > db.system.roles.find() 或者 > db.getRoles...3.2.1 数据库用户角色 数据库级别角色如下: ——读取所有非系统集合上数据 读写——包括所有“”角色特权和在所有非系统集合上写数据能力 3.2.2 数据库管理员角色 可以使用数据库管理员角色如下

1.5K20

CDP中Hive3系列之保护Hive3

'/users/andrena'; Hive 为hive用户分配默认权限 777 ,设置 umask 以限制子目录,并提供默认 ACL 以授予 Hive 对所有子目录写访问权限。...Hive 强制访问;但是,如果您为销售用户提供较少通过 SBA 访问选项,例如将用户对表 HDFS 访问权限设置为只读,Ranger 将无法控制该用户访问权限。...如果您使用 SBA,您需要知道哪些 Hive 操作对您 Hive 数据库和具有读写访问权限。...Hive 操作所需最低权限 操作 数据库访问 数据库写入访问 访问 写入访问 LOAD X EXPORT X IMPORT X CREATE TABLE X CREATE...您需要适当存储权限才能写入目标分区或位置。您需要配置 HWC 读取选项。您需要配置 HWC 读取选项。

2.3K30
  • Apollo 源码解析 —— Portal 认证与授权(二)之授权

    权限模型 常见权限模型,有两种:RBAC 和 ACL 。如果不了解胖友,可以看下 《基于AOP实现权限管理:访问控制模型 RBAC 和 ACL 》 。...笔者一开始看到 Role + UserRole + Permission + RolePermission 四张,认为是 RBAC 权限模型。...2.3 Permission Permission 权限,对应实体 com.ctrip.framework.apollo.portal.entity.po.Permission ,代码如下: @Entity...targetId 字段,目标编号。 例子如下图: ? 为什么不是 Namespace 编号?Namespace 级别,是所有环境 + 所有集群都有权限,所以不能具体某个 Namespace 。...2.4 RolePermission RolePermission ,角色与权限关联,对应实体 com.ctrip.framework.apollo.portal.entity.po.RolePermission

    1.5K30

    Spring 全家桶之 Spring Security(三)

    一、自定义RBAC实现认证 创建自定义用户,角色和用户角色关系 SET NAMES utf8mb4; SET FOREIGN_KEY_CHECKS = 0; -- -------------...= #{userId} 创建自定义UserDetailsService实现类 重写方法中查询数据库获取用户信息,获取角色数据,构建UserDetails...,给READ角色配置了/access/read访问权限 ,给ADMIN角色配置了/access/admin访问权限 17.验证权限,重新启动应用,打开首页如下,为保证正确性,首先清楚浏览器缓存,三个用户...其他页面,访问异常 由于Thor账户还有ADMIN角色,所以ADMIN页面也是可以正常访问 清楚浏览器缓存,使用READ角色Stark账号访问,read页面可以正常访问 试试其他页面,访问...目前为止,已经实现在自定义数据库情况下实现用户认证和权限鉴别,并且通过了测试。

    54710

    《ASP.NET Core 与 RESTful API 开发实战》-- (第8章)-- 读书笔记(中)

    } } 接下来,修改 LibraryDbContext,使其派生自 IdentityDbContext 类,TKey 类型参数是用户与角色主键字段类型... EF Core 迁移,该迁移包含了创建与 Identity 相关数据操作,并将其修改应用到数据库中 接下来,在 AuthenticateController 中添加创建用户方法,并修改原来对用户信息验证逻辑...Claim 以及角色,这些信息最终都会包含在生成 Token 中 运行程序,注册用户,获取用户信息后请求 token2 接下来介绍授权及其实现 通过 UserManager 类提供方法可以将用户添加到角色中...则要求用户必须具有类型为 UserId Claim,且它值必须为指定值 创建之后,只要在添加 [Authorize] 特性时候指定 Policy 属性即可 [Authorize(Policy...= "ManagerOnly")] 复杂授权策略需要通过 IAuthorizationRequirement 接口和 AuthorizationHandler 类实现 实现只有注册日期超过3天后才有权限访问

    86010

    PostgreSQL用户角色和权限管理

    4.赋予权限 GRANT示例: GRANT示例:GRANT ALL ON database dbname TO rolename; GRANT UPDATE ON tabname TO demo_role...UPDATE (col1) ON mytable TO miriam_rw; #列授权 特殊符号:ALL代表所访问权限,PUBLIC代表所有用户 5.查看权限 显示角色属性(包含系统权限): \du...或\du+ [username] 查看系统: select * from pg_roles|pg_user; 查看某用户或角色权限: select * from information_schema.table_privileges...where grantee='repuser'; 显示对象访问权限列表: \z或\dp [tablename] 6.回收权限: REVOKE 语法格式如下: REVOKE permission_type...7.权限实验 appadmin下app1无法使用appadmin用户创建: set role appadmin;后可以使用了: 8.创建用户赋权 ---- 墨天轮原文链接:https://

    4.6K21

    学习学习SpringSecurity

    ## 角色权限控制 当我们系统功能模块当需求发展到一定程度时,会不同用户,不同角色使用我们系统。这样就要求我们系统可以做到,能够对不同系统功能模块,开放给对应拥有其访问权限用户使用。...Spring Security提供了Spring EL表达式,允许我们在定义URL路径访问(@RequestMapping)方法上面添加注解,来控制访问权限。...在标注访问权限时,根据对应表达式返回结果,控制访问权限: true,表示有权限 fasle,表示无权限 新建新控制器 package com.example.demo.web; import org.springframework.web.bind.annotation.RequestMapping...类,使用scalaforeach,编译器会提示无法找到resultforeach方法。..., user.password, authorities) } } 在上方,通过内部类方式,获取到了一个User对象。

    59100

    数据库PostrageSQL-管理数据库

    通常每个数据库对象(、函数等) 属于并且只属于一个数据库(不过有几个系统如pg_database属于整个集簇并且对集簇中每个数据库都是可访问)。...更准确地说,一个数据库是一个模式集合, 而模式包含、函数等等。因此完整层次是这样:服务器、数据库、模式、(或者某些其他对象类型,如函数)。...如果项目或者用户是相互关联, 并且可以相互使用对方资源,那么应该把它们放在同一个数据库里,但可能在不同模式中。 模式只是一个纯粹逻辑结构并且谁能访问某个模式由权限系统管理。...要实现这个目标,使用下列命令之一: 用于 SQL 环境 CREATE DATABASE dbname OWNER rolename; 或者用于 shell createdb -O rolename...dbname 只有超级用户才被允许为其他人(即为一个你不是其成员角色)创建一个数据库。

    2K10

    Spring Security入门(三): 基于自定义数据库查询认证实战

    extends Serializable { //获取权限列表 Collection<?...; //......此处省略setter和getter方法 } 2 用于认证用户信息数据库访问层 2.1 新建与用户对应Repository接口 public interface...在TblUserRepository接口中我们自定义了一个根据username字段查找用户信息方法,继承自JpaRepository接口数据库访问接口无需开发人员手动实现其中 2.2 新建与角色对应...》基础上对所有用户进入登录页面和登录接口放开权限,而对/index/*路径下接口允许访问角色改为数据库中存在Admin,SystemAdmin,Developer等角色。...,简称鉴权(authorization) (2)利用SecurityContextHolder获取用户认证信息和权限代码实例如下: SecurityContext context = SecurityContextHolder.getContext

    1.5K40

    MySQL 数据库常用命令小结

    用户权限控制:grant    库,权限控制 : 将某个库中某个控制权赋予某个用户    Grant all ON db_name.table_name TO user_name [...mysql> SHOW TABLES; 10、显示(db)内容 mysql>select * from db; 11、命令取消 当命令输入错误而又无法改变(多行语句情形)时,只要在分号出现前就可以用...这样用户即使用知道test2密码,他也无法从internet上直接访问数据库,只能通过MYSQL主机上web页来访问了。...MySql用户管理是通过 User来实现,添加新用户常用方法有两个,一是在User插入相应数据行,同时设置相应权限;二是通过GRANT命令创建具有某种权限用 户。...RELOAD: 重载访问控制表,刷新日志等。 SHUTDOWN: 关闭MySQL服务。 数据库/数据/数据列权限: ALTER: 修改已存在数据(例如增加/删除列)和索引。

    98220

    3-4 文件流类FileStream

    在构造函数中使用 FilePath, FileMode, FileAccess, FileShare分别是指:使用指定路径、创建模式、/写权限和共享权限。...FileAccess Read、ReadWrite和Write 定义用于控制对文件访问写访问/写访问常数。...试图从使用 Truncate 打开文件中进行读取将导致异常。 3-11 枚举类型FileAccess枚举值含义 成员名称 说明 Read 对文件访问。可从文件中读取数据。...同 Write 组合即构成读写访问权。 ReadWrite 对文件访问写访问。可从文件读取数据和将数据写入文件。 Write 文件写访问。可将数据写入文件。...同 Read 组合即构成/写访问权。 3-12 枚举类型FileShare枚举值含义 成员名称 说明 Delete 允许随后删除文件。 Inheritable 使文件句柄可由子进程继承。

    70020

    Daily-Blog项目后台日志

    (); } } 后台权限控制及其动态路由 分析 权限 对应页面 权限 角色权限 获取当前用户权限和角色信息 接口(getInfo) 实现getInfo 最终实现结果 { "code...首先查询对应用户菜单 /** * 根据用户id查询相关权限菜单信息 * @param userId 用户id * @return 返回符合要求val */ @Override...menus = menuMapper.selectRouterMenuTreeByUserId(userId); } //通过上述得到Menu无法得到我们需要父子菜单管理...只针对有权限用户访问能够访问信息 操作 在springSecurity中添加 @Configuration @EnableGlobalMethodSecurity(prePostEnabled =...true) public class SecurityConfig extends WebSecurityConfigurerAdapter { 在需要访问方法上加 封装权限到loginUser中

    31810

    阿里巴巴开源DataX全量同步多个MySQL数据库

    前言 上次 写了阿里巴巴高效离线数据同步工具DataX: https://mp.weixin.qq.com/s/_ZXqA3H__Kwk-9O-9dKyOQ 安装DataX这个开源工具,并且同步备份了几张数据...思路 实现目标如图,要将源数据库所有数据全量同步到目标数据库中。 三个步骤 1.源库数据库结构导入到目标库中 2.读取目标库中所有名 3.通过DataX执行脚本同步所有数据。...操作流程 1.源库数据库结构导入到目标库中 利用shell脚本读取数据库,导出结构 https://gitee.com/funet8/MYSQL/raw/master/DataX/Mysql_Init.sh.../etc/profile # 变量 r_ip="192.168.1.6" r_port="3306" r_username="root" r_password="123456" # 写入库变量.../etc/profile # 变量 r_ip="192.168.1.6" r_port="3306" r_username="root" r_password="123456" # 写入库变量

    2.1K21

    Mysql 常用命令

    去除重复字段 mysqladmin drop databasename; 删除数据库前,有提示 select version(),current_date; 显示当前 mysql 版本和当前日期...delete from user where user="root" and host="%"; flush privileges; 创建一个用户deploy在特定客户端 linuxprobe登录,可访问特定数据库...-u root -p dbname < dbname_backup.sql 如果只想卸出建指令,则命令如下: mysqladmin -u root -p -d databasename...我上次字符集是数据库级,对表 sysuser 没有影响,所以出现了改了字符集却一样无法插入中文情况。 Drop TABLE IF EXISTS `firstdb`....默认字符集被设定为 character_set_database,也就是这个数据库默认字符集; 当在内设置一栏时,除非明确指定,否则此栏缺省字符集就是默认字符集; 这个字符集就是数据库中实际存储数据采用字符集

    48820
    领券